This week, Justin and Doug chat about misleading ads found in some of the mobile games they play, why “try hards” can be annoying in gaming, and the art of having fun while losing. Doug then talks to his dream of playing games with his daughter when she gets older.
Things are wrapped up with a throw-down featuring Chucky vs. a gremlin.
